Gear and Item Set Info

 

2 Piece Blood Spawn / Infused Head / Sturdy or Divines Shoulder  (Prismatic Enchants)

5 Piece Ebon / Infused Chest and Legs / Divines or Sturdy Feet Hands and Waist (Prismatic Enchants)

5 Piece Knightmare / 3 Healthy Jewelry (Block Cost Reduction Enchants) / 2  Defending Swords (Crusher Enchant) and 2 Reinforced Shields (Prismatic Enchant)

This is kinda a filler setup until I get my alkosh set then the knightmare will be replaced with alkosh

There are a couple of good crafted alternatives if your still farming knightmare and alkosh ebon is the cornerstone so make sure that is your first farm trial groups go gaga over a tank with red balls. Just don't use ebon weapons or shields due to a persistant bug when switching weapons you lose the buff. I would run ebon jewelry and two pieces of armor then craft up a set of either Tavas Favor (Great for Ulti Building) or Hist Bark (Love the Block Dodge) keep the same traits and enchants as above. So it would be...

2 Piece Blood Spawn / Infused Head / Sturdy or Divines Shoulder  (Prismatic Enchants)

5 Piece Ebon / 3 Healthy Jewelry (Block Cost Reduction Enchants) / Divines or Sturdy Feet and Waist (Prismatic Enchant) this could be any two armor pieces whichever you have

5 Piece Tavas or Hist Bark / 2  Defending Swords (Crusher Enchant) and 2 Reinforced Shields (Prismatic Enchant) / Divines or Sturdy Chest Legs and Hands or whichever 3 you didn't use for the Ebon set (Prismatic Defence

 

General Info

 

PASSIVES:

Take all the class passives / All the Sword and Shield Passives / All the Heavy Armor Passives / All the Undaunted Passives.

After that the rest is up to you 

FOOD - Tri-Stat Purple CP 150 Food

POTIONS - Tri Potions (Use only if necessary) Mostly use Cheap Stam Potions

MUNDUS STONE - Personal Choice although I reccomend either the Steed for health recovery or the Ritual for more self heals

This build is fairly strong and can handle much punnishment. You have 2 shields for oh crap moments also you have a HoT and a burst heal. Now it isn't a Block Knight so just watch your stamina while blocking and use your shields once in a while to take the heat off your stamina weave some heavy attacks in and ask for shards if needed and you should be fine.
